System and method for performing external and internal inspections of wind turbine blades
Systems and methods for performing external inspections and internal inspections on wind turbine blades and correlating the external and internal inspections with one another are disclosed herein. A method of inspecting a wind turbine blade includes analyzing an exterior of the blade to produce external blade data, analyzing an interior of the blade to produce internal blade data, correlating a first position of the internal blade data with a second position of the external blade, and displaying an image including the first position and the second position.

METHOD AND A SYSTEM FOR HANDLING PHYSICAL INTRUSION IN A WIND TURBINE
A method for handling physical intrusion in a wind turbine (1) is disclosed. An intrusion detection system (3) detects an intrusion event in the wind turbine (1), generates a first intrusion alert signal and provides the first intrusion alert signal to a control system (4) of the wind turbine (1). In response to receiving the first intrusion alert signal, the control system (4) initiates at least one safety action at the wind turbine (1), wherein the at least one safety action comprises stopping power production of the wind turbine (1) and providing a second intrusion alert signal to an intrusion monitoring system (6). The intrusion monitoring system (6) communicatively isolates the wind turbine (1).
